Illegal Russian Tour Guide Arrested in Thalang

Thalang –

An illegal Russian tour guide was arrested in Mai Khao on Friday (March 22nd).

The Phuket Tourist Police told the Phuket Express that at 8:00 A.M. on the day in question they arrested a suspect identified only as MR. IAKHIA, 28, Russian national. He was arrested at a pier near the local beach called Pak Phra Beach in the Mai Khao sub-district, Thalang.

He was taken to the Tha Chatchai Police Station to face charges of being an illegal tour guide as well as being a foreigner doing a protected job (tour guide). The Phuket Express notes that tour guides are a protected occupation in Thailand and that work permits and visas are unavailable to foreigners for this job.
